Skip to content

maycompires/Exercicio_ResponsiveWebDevelopment

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

4 Commits
 
 
 
 
 
 
 
 

Repository files navigation

https://maycompires.github.io/semana-09-04-2024/

DOM + Olá Mundo

Um projeto simples que demonstra o uso do DOM (Modelo de Objeto de Documento) em JavaScript para interação com elementos HTML, incluindo a exibição dinâmica de mensagens e uma calculadora básica.

Instalação

Não é necessário nenhum tipo de instalação. Basta abrir o arquivo index.html em um navegador da web para visualizar a aplicação.

Estrutura do Projeto

  • index.html: Contém a estrutura HTML do projeto, incluindo os elementos DOM e os botões para interação.
  • style.css: Arquivo CSS para estilização do projeto.
  • main.js: Arquivo JavaScript que contém as funções para interação com o DOM.

Funcionalidades

  1. Mensagem de Boas-Vindas:

    • Ao clicar no botão "Clique Aqui", uma mensagem de boas-vindas é exibida dinamicamente.
  2. Calculadora Simples:

    • A calculadora permite ao usuário digitar dois números e calcular a soma deles ao clicar no botão "Calcular".
  3. Alterar Propriedade por ID:

    • Um botão permite alterar a propriedade de um elemento por seu ID quando clicado.
  4. Alterar Propriedade por Name:

    • Outro botão permite alterar a propriedade de um elemento por seu atributo de nome (name).
  5. Alterar Propriedade por Classe:

    • Um terceiro botão permite alterar a propriedade de todos os elementos com uma determinada classe.

Instruções de Uso

  1. Abra o arquivo index.html em um navegador da web.
  2. Interaja com os diferentes elementos e botões para ver as funcionalidades em ação.

Contribuição

Contribuições são bem-vindas! Sinta-se à vontade para enviar sugestões, relatar problemas ou enviar solicitações de pull requests.

Licença

Este projeto está licenciado sob a MIT License

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published